The holiday season in Clemson is always a special time, but there is one tradition our members look forward to more than any other: the annual Clemson Area Chamber Christmas Party.
This year, on Thursday, December 4th, we gathered at the beautiful Inn at Patrick Square for an evening of festive networking, live music, and—most importantly—community impact. The boutique charm of the Inn provided the perfect backdrop for our members to toast to a successful year and look ahead to 2026.
